This piece left me speechless. Guitar, voice and saxophone create something that is more than the sum of its parts. It just stirred me. So, (so far) lacking any bass remix, I tried to play something that might work with it. For my fellow bass players, some info on the tone: Ibanez SR650E with Elixir nickels. Passive mode, only neck pickup, tone at 30%, 10 band EQ with everything flat except for a -6Db cut at 500Hz (cleans up the sound) and ...
